Failsafe Parameters (P070 to P072)

As preset, in the event of a measurement or technical difficulty, the DPS300 holds
the Reading, Bar Graph, mA outputs, and relays at their last "known" values.
To operate process control equipment under these conditions, alter the following
parameters as required.
Note:
If alternate Failsafe Operation is not required, proceed to RELAY PARAMETERS.
P070 Failsafe Timer
Enter the time to elapse (in minutes), upon a difficulty, before failsafe operation is
activated.
In the RUN mode, when a difficulty first occurs, the Reading, Bar Graph, relay
status, and mA outputs are held at "last known" values and the Failsafe Timer is
activated.
When a valid measurement is made before the timer expires, the DPS300
advances to the "new" material level (if changed) and the timer resets.
If the timer expires (before a valid measurement is made), the DPS300 advances
to the Failsafe Material Level (P071) as restricted by Failsafe Advance (P072).
When a valid measurement is made after the timer expires, the DPS300 advances
to the "new" sludge level (if changed), as restricted by Failsafe Advance (P072)
and the timer resets.
If the timer expires due to a measurement difficulty, "LOE" flashes in the Reading
display.
Technical difficulty messages flash in the Reading display before the timer
expires. The offending terminal connections are displayed in the Auxiliary Reading
display.

Note:
While a short duration Failsafe Timer value may be required (when process
control equipment is used) avoid entering a value so short as to cause nuisance
activation.
